Storage & Handling
Store at -20°C for one year. For short term storage and frequent use, store at 4°C for up to one month. Av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les.

Answer
Our lab technicians have not validated anti-ITCH Monoclonal antibody M00195 on pig. You can run a BLAST between pig and the immunogen sequence of anti-ITCH Monoclonal antibody M00195 to see if they may cross-react. If the sequence homology is close, then you can perform a pilot test. Keep in mind that since we have not validated pig samples, this use of the antibody is not covered by our guarantee.
